
Once you've unlocked your Apple Watch, wrist detection can keep it unlocked for as long as it maintains skin contact.
As security systems go, wrist detection is clever: It lets you have the convenience of accessing your
Apple Watch without having to continually re-enter your passcode or password, but provides enough security to protect your data, including
Apple Pay credentials under normal circumstances. In that way it's similar to
Touch ID, which can unlock your iPhone or iPad based on your fingerprint.
